If you’re looking at auctioning off your Southwest Michigan house, keep in mind that there are several preparations that you must make before the actual auction starts.

The “Do’s” 

  • In order to actually get your house auctioned off, you must first find an auctioneer in Southwest Michigan.There are many auctioneering companies out there today, so do your research before picking one to represent your house.  One place you can start is your local phone book, a referral, or head over to the National Auctioneers Association website and do a quick search for auctioneers here in our area of MI.Look for those with plenty of experience, and even try attending an auction or two, just to get a feel for how they run things. Make sure to find out their fees that they charge for their services, as they can sometimes run quite high. In some instances they may take up to ten percent of the houses cost, greatly reducing the amount of profit that you will receive… sometimes much lower.Or heck, if you don’t want to hire an auctioneer… you can do it yourself. A good auctioneer can really help drive the price of a house up with their skill… but you can run the auction yourself as long as you’re clear about the rules of the auction with bidders, the starting bid price, whether they have to have cash and a deposit at the auction, etc.
  • Decide which kind of auction you want to run – Absolute or Reserve?Once you feel that you’ve selected the house auctioneering company in Southwest Michigan that’s best for you, establish which kind of auction you want it to be, absolute or reserve.In absolute auctions there is no minimum limit that your house must earn in order to be sold. This means that whatever the highest bid may be, is what you’re going to get.Reserve auctions are those that have a minimum limit, and if it doesn’t reach that limit, it doesn’t get sold.

    Although it seems like a clear choice between the two, don’t assume that reserve auctions are necessarily better. Sometimes if bidders aren’t willing to reach the limit, it will never be sold and you’ll be sitting on a house that you don’t want.  Also, auctions that are “no reserve” (or absolute) tend to attract more potential bidders to the auction looking for a great deal… and if one of them gets wrapped up in the bidding frenzie… that could mean the difference between selling the house that day and not selling it.

    Think carefully about making a decision, and try to decide what it is that you want more. If you want to sell your house as quickly as possible in Southwest Michigan, then doing an absolute auction is the quicker option. If not, then perhaps a reserve auction would be more in your goals.

  • Don’t leave out any faults about the house from your auction description A crucial step in successfully selling your house at auction in Southwest Michigan involves creating a comprehensive and transparent list of all existing issues related to your property. It is imperative not to omit any faults or defects concerning your house, as this could lead to potential legal ramifications. Buyers have the right to seek recourse if they discover undisclosed flaws after the auction has taken place. By being forthright and detailing all known problems beforehand, you not only protect yourself legally but also foster trust and transparency with potential buyers. This approach will contribute to a smoother auction process and help you avoid any unpleasant surprises or disputes after the sale has been completed.

  • Don’t go into an auction with fantasies of a bidding war erupting, leaving you with an enormous profit.

When auctioning your house in Southwest Michigan, it’s important to set a realistic asking price that reflects the property’s true market value. Keep in mind that you might have an emotional attachment to the house that potential bidders do not share, which could influence your perception of its worth. Be prepared for the possibility that your house may sell for less than your initial expectations, and try not to let disappointment overshadow the benefits of a successful sale.

While an auction might yield a lower sale price compared to a traditional real estate transaction, it offers several advantages. Auctions are generally faster, allowing you to expedite the selling process and avoid the drawn-out, often stressful experience of a conventional property sale. By opting for an auction in Southwest Michigan, you can save yourself time, emotional strain, and potentially even financial burdens associated with a more traditional approach to selling your home.
